Understanding the Sector and Range of Specializations
Mechanic training in Germany encompasses a wide range of specializations, reflecting the country’s industrial diversity and advanced technology sectors. Programs include automotive mechanics, industrial maintenance, mechatronics, precision engineering, hydraulics, and electromechanical systems. Students learn through Germany’s renowned dual education system, which combines classroom learning at vocational schools (Berufsschule) with practical experience in companies. This structure ensures that training remains closely aligned with real industry needs. Courses cover topics such as diagnostics, machine maintenance, system calibration, automation, and quality control. The use of advanced technologies — including robotics, digital monitoring tools, and energy-efficient systems — prepares trainees for the realities of modern industrial workplaces. The collaborative approach between schools and employers helps students develop discipline, problem-solving skills, and technical precision, while gaining experience in high-tech workshops and factories.

Daily Routines and the Role of Practical Training
A mechanic’s daily routine in Germany emphasizes accuracy, structure, and teamwork. Tasks include diagnosing mechanical or electrical issues, performing preventive maintenance, replacing components, and testing complex systems. During training, students spend most of their time in workshops, applying theoretical knowledge to real machinery and industrial systems. Safety and precision are central to every activity — from assembling engines to programming maintenance tools. German mechanic training places strong emphasis on repetition and mastery: learners are encouraged to refine their skills through continuous practice and close supervision by experienced professionals. Environmental awareness is also a core part of training, as sustainability and energy efficiency become increasingly vital in the country’s industrial practices. This blend of discipline, organization, and practical experience defines the German approach to mechanical education, ensuring that graduates can perform confidently and competently in any industrial environment.
